bitget token是什么
发表于 2025年8月19日 · 阅读 12,394

在数字化时代,我们的生活中充斥着各式各样的在线服务和应用。为了实现不同服务之间的安全通信和数据共享,一个重要的概念——“贝壳获取令牌”(bitget token)横空出世。本文将围绕“贝壳获取令牌”这一主题进行深入探讨,旨在帮助读者全面理解它的含义、作用以及背后的技术原理。


什么是贝壳获取令牌(bitget token)?


在互联网世界里,用户与服务器的交互往往需要经过一系列的身份验证和数据保护流程。为了确保交互的安全性和合法性,服务器通常会要求客户端提供一个临时或长期的凭证——即“贝壳获取令牌”。这个令牌是由客户端生成并通过安全的方式传输到服务器,从而获得对相应资源的访问权限。


作用与功能


1. 身份验证:令牌包含了用户的身份信息,通过一定的加密算法保护这些信息不被非法读取或篡改。用户使用这个令牌与服务器的交互可以看作是对其真实性的认证。


2. 安全通信:在客户端和服务器之间进行数据交换时,贝壳获取令牌作为安全的传输层协议(如JSON Web Tokens, JWT)来保护数据的完整性、机密性和时间戳的正确性。


3. 授权管理:服务端根据收到的令牌信息来授予或限制用户对系统资源的访问权限。令牌携带了用户的权限信息和相关的权限控制规则,保证了应用的安全运行。


实现原理


要生成和使用贝壳获取令牌,通常需要以下几个步骤:


1. 密钥管理:服务端和客户端共享一个密钥(secret)。在这个过程中,密钥的保密性至关重要,通常只能由服务器持有。


2. 令牌生成:用户在登录时通过密码或两因素认证等方式进行身份验证,随后,根据安全协议的要求,服务器生成一个新的令牌,并将其与用户的身份信息关联起来。


3. 传输加密:生成的令牌通常采用加密的方式传输到客户端。这个过程中需要确保传输路径的安全性,防止中间人攻击。


4. 解密验证:客户端收到令牌后,通过共享的密钥对令牌进行解密。这一步的目的是为了验证令牌是否来自合法的服务端,以及其内容的真实性。


5. 请求授权:在后续的数据请求中,客户端携带这个经过验证的令牌向服务器发送请求。服务端检查令牌的有效性并决定是否允许用户访问相应的资源。


安全性和局限性


贝壳获取令牌的安全性是其最大的优势之一。通过使用加密技术、时间戳和权限管理策略,它能够有效地防止重放攻击、篡改伪造等潜在的威胁。然而,任何一种安全机制都有其局限性:


1. 密钥管理:如果服务端的密钥被泄露或窃取,那么所有的令牌都可能失去作用。因此,密钥的安全存储和保护是整个系统的关键。


2. 用户体验:频繁的登录验证可能会对用户的便捷性造成负面影响。为了解决这个问题,通常会为用户的令牌设定过期时间,并在过期后自动刷新。


3. 跨域问题:在多平台应用中,由于不同域名的不同安全策略和资源隔离原则,需要特别设计支持跨域的贝壳获取令牌解决方案。


综上所述,贝壳获取令牌是现代应用程序安全通信和授权管理的关键技术之一。它通过提供安全的传输协议、有效的身份验证机制和对资源的权限控制,确保了在线服务的可靠性和用户数据的完整性。然而,为了最大化其安全性并优化用户体验,开发者需要仔细设计和实施相应的令牌管理系统。

作者简介:本文作者为财经观察专栏撰稿人,长期关注宏观经济、区块链及资本市场动态,致力于提供深度解读与前沿观点。